ابن ماجہchevron_rightكتاب إقامة الصلاة والسنةchevron_rightHadith #1214chevron_right


حَدَّثَنَا عَلِيُّ بْنُ مُحَمَّدٍ ح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و أُسَامَةَ عَنْ ابْنِ عَوْنٍ عَنْ ابْنِ سِيرِينَ عَنْ أَبِي هُرَيْرَةَ قَالَ صَلَّی بِنَ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ّی ا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 إِحْدَی صَلَاتَيْ الْعَشِيِّ رَکْعَتَيْنِ ثُمَّ سَلَّمَ ثُمَّ قَامَ إِلَی خَشَبَةٍ کَانَتْ فِي الْمَسْجِدِ يَسْتَنِدُ إِلَيْهَا فَخَرَجَ سَرَعَانُ النَّاسِ يَقُولُونَ قَصُرَتْ الصَّلَاةُ وَفِي الْقَوْمِ أَبُو بَکْرٍ وَعُمَرُ فَهَابَاهُ أَنْ يَقُولَا لَهُ شَيْئًا وَفِي الْقَوْمِ رَجُلٌ طَوِيلُ الْيَدَيْنِ يُسَمَّی ذَا الْيَدَيْنِ فَقَالَ يَا رَسُولَ اللَّهِ أَقَصُرَتْ الصَّلَاةُ أَمْ نَسِيتَ فَقَالَ لَمْ تَقْصُرْ وَلَمْ أَنْسَ قَالَ فَإِنَّمَا صَلَّيْتَ رَکْعَتَيْنِ فَقَالَ أَکَمَا يَقُولُ ذُو الْيَدَيْنِ فَقَالُوا نَعَمْ فَقَامَ فَصَلَّی رَکْعَتَيْنِ ثُمَّ سَلَّمَ ثُمَّ سَجَدَ سَجْدَتَيْنِ ثُمَّ سَلَّمَ

ابن ماجہ · Hadith 1214

It was narrated that Abu Hurairah said: "The Messenger of Allah SAW led us in one of the afternoon prayers, and he prayed two Rak'ah, then he said the Salam. Then he stood up and went to a piece of wood in the Masjid, and leaned against it. Those who were in a hurry left the Masjid, saying that the prayer had been shortened. Among the people were Abu Bakr and 'Umar, but they dared not say anything. Among the people there was also a man with long hands who was called Dhul-Yadain. He said: ‘O Messenger of Allah, has the prayer been shortened or did you forget?' He said: 'It has not been shortened and I did not forget.' He said: 'But you prayed two Rak' ah.' He said: 'Is what Dhul- Yadain says true?' They said: 'Yes.' So he went forward and performed two Rak'ah and said the Salam, then he prostrated twice, and then he said the Salam again."(Sahih).
